Different Drug Treatment Facility Types

If you have a drug or alcohol problem and you are looking into drug treatment facilities, then you have already taken a very important step. You'll want to know about the different options out there and what you can expect. This article will give you some insight into the different types of programs there are and what they have to offer you.

Detox facility

If you are regularly drinking or regularly using hard drugs, then you may need to go to a detox facility first. In this type of facility, they will help you to come down off of the alcohol or drugs safely. The programs can differ as to weather they keep you after detox for a period of time to council you or they are just a stepping stone you pass over on your way to another facility once you have detoxed.

Short term facility

There are shorter term facilities available you can go to that can run from anywhere from a few weeks to 6 months. These facilities focus on giving you a start on the tools you are going to need in order to maintain your sobriety in the real world. You will stay in the facility and there will be rules regarding contacting friends and family, as well as regarding leaving the premises. While you may not like the idea of these rules, they are part of a proven system put in place to get you the best results, so you have the best chance of recovery.

Long term facility

There are also long-term facilities where you can plan on spending anywhere from 6 months to a year in. While this may seem like a long time, it is often the amount of time needed for someone suffering with alcoholism and addiction who is going to need to have a lot of tools and education to take with them back out in the world in order to succeed. When you are in these long-term facilities, they may also have programs in place that help to reintegrate you back into the working class. They may also have classes to help with things such as getting your GED, getting your license or other classes to help you be ahead once you go back home.

Meetings

Once you get out of any type of facility, it is important for you to attend meetings regularly. At these meetings you will get a sponsor who will help you to maintain your sobriety and you will be able to share, which will help you get things off your shoulders.
